People of Dungdara kreeri protest against R&B department Baramulla

Baramulla : The residents of Dungdaara Kreeri and adjoining areas protested against the R&B Department at Kreeri village of Baramulla north Kashmir for want of upgrading the bridge in the area.
The bridge was constructed in 2012, connecting dozens of village in outskirts of Baramulla .

They alleged  that total estimated cost of bridge was 1 crore 90 lakhs which was released but  the bridge is yet to be completed.

Locals appealed Governor  to investigate into the matter so that general public doesn’t suffer.

Gh Qadir a resident said tha ” in the departmental documents the work on bridge is completed”.

Xen R&B Department  Baramulla said that they will investigate the matter and pending work on bridge will start very soon.
“We made DPR in 2018,  we are waiting for repky from higher authorities,” He said.
